After the cast had a little seat time on the 
                                quads, an actual race was set up between the two 
                                teams and one of the most memorable scenes from 
                                the race involves a whole lot of mud. “John 
                                went out and dug this huge mud pit for the cast 
                                to race through, but it actually ended up in a 
                                big mud wrestling contest,” said Krista 
                                about her favorite segment. “They were all 
                                covered in mud. It’s not everyday you get 
                                to see something like that!” she concluded. 
                                “The mud pit was really something. I worked 
                                on that for a whole day before we filmed and it 
                                turned out to be a really fun thing for everyone 
                                I think,” John added.

                                      TV show |  According to cast and crew, the ATV racing episode 
                                of “Gone Country” is a favorite among 
                                many. “The filming schedule was really brutal 
                                and the cast worked very hard. They were really 
                                excited to be able to get out on the quads and 
                                have some time to play around,” said Renfroe. 
                                “ATV riding is a great sport whether you’re 
                                racing or just riding the trails and I think the 
                                show is going to let a lot of people see just 
                                how fun quads are,” added Krista.  “I hope that everyone who sees the show, 
                                sees how easy it can be when you learn how to 
                                ride the right way, and see how fun it is to ride, 
                                and want to become involved in the sport. I think 
                                this show portrays the fun aspect of it really 
                                well,” said John. The crew made sure that 
                                all safety issues were covered during the show 
                                as well, such as proper riding gear and wearing 
                                helmets, in order to represent quads in a positive 
                                way.
